Description
• Error coins are some of the rarest numismatic items in existence as they are all one-of-a-kind
• This 1800 Draped Bust Silver Dollar is an example of the Doublestruck in Collar error
• With an incredibly low mintage of only 220,920 coins, finding an 1800 Draped Bust Silver Dollar in any condition is a miracle
• After this coin was struck, it remained in the coin collar and was struck again, creating a second rotated image on the planchet
